Statement of Significance
Contribution to the landscape
Rare or localised
These trees appear to have been severely pollarded at 3.5m but still make an impressive contribution to the landscape. An uncommon cultivar in Victoria, with other known occurrences at Wallan, Gisborne, Kyneton and Fawkner Park.
The measured tree, at the northern end, is the largest known example in Victoria.
Measurements: 23/03/1997
Spread (m): 19
Girth (m): 3.85
Height (m): 21.75
Estimated Age (yrs): 100
Condition: Good
Access: Unrestricted
Classified: 10/04/1997
